Allegany College of Maryland vs. PGCC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Allegany College of Maryland or PGCC?

  • Allegany College of Maryland is 63.9% more expensive to attend than PGCC for in-state tuition ($8,220.00 vs. $5,016.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 49.9% higher at Allegany College of Maryland than Prince George's Community College ($11,190.00 vs. $7,464.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Allegany College of Maryland than PGCC ($9,279 vs. $10,382)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Allegany College of Maryland are 68% lower than costs at Prince George's Community College ($10,650 vs. $17,890)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Allegany College of Maryland than Prince George's Community College (89% vs. 64%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Prince George's Community College students is 6.5% larger than aid received Allegany College of Maryland ($6,190 vs. $5,811)

Allegany College of Maryland vs. PGCC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Allegany College of Maryland or PGCC?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between PGCC and Allegany College of Maryland.

  • Graduates from Prince George's Community College earn on average $9,600 more per year than Allegany College of Maryland graduates after ten years. ($42,500 vs. $32,900)
  • Prince George's Community College students graduate with a $7,250 lower median federal student loan debt than Allegany College of Maryland graduates. ($8,000 vs. $15,250)
  • PGCC graduates are paying $75 less per month on federal student loans than Allegany College of Maryland graduates. ($82 vs. $157)
  • More Allegany College of Maryland gra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former PGCC students, three years after graduation. (44% vs. 30%)
